projects/mesxc-lb #281

Manually merged
juzi merged 6 commits from projects/mesxc-lb into projects/mesxc-test 2024-03-27 09:18:06 +08:00
3 changed files with 11 additions and 13 deletions
Showing only changes of commit afa3f7c6f5 - Show all commits

View File

@ -73,7 +73,7 @@
<el-date-picker <el-date-picker
v-model="dataForm.planCheckTime" v-model="dataForm.planCheckTime"
type="datetime" type="datetime"
placeholder="请选择计划开始时间" placeholder="请选择实际巡检时间"
value-format="timestamp"></el-date-picker> value-format="timestamp"></el-date-picker>
</el-form-item> </el-form-item>
</el-col> </el-col>
@ -107,6 +107,9 @@ export default {
name: [ name: [
{ required: true, message: '巡检单名称不能为空', trigger: 'blur' }, { required: true, message: '巡检单名称不能为空', trigger: 'blur' },
], ],
planCheckTime: [
{ required: true, message: '巡检时间不能为空', trigger: 'blur' },
],
}, },
equipmentOptions: [], equipmentOptions: [],
groupOptions: [], groupOptions: [],

View File

@ -157,16 +157,8 @@ export default {
], ],
bind: { bind: {
clearable: true, clearable: true,
filterable: true filterable: true,
}
}, },
{
input: true,
label: '巡检项目',
prop: 'program',
rules: [
{ required: true, message: '巡检项目不能为空', trigger: 'blur' },
],
}, },
], ],
[ [

View File

@ -7,6 +7,7 @@ function resolve(dir) {
} }
const CompressionPlugin = require('compression-webpack-plugin') const CompressionPlugin = require('compression-webpack-plugin')
const BundleAnalyzerPlugin = require('webpack-bundle-analyzer').BundleAnalyzerPlugin
const name = process.env.VUE_APP_TITLE || '中建材智能自动化研究院有限公司' // 网页标题 const name = process.env.VUE_APP_TITLE || '中建材智能自动化研究院有限公司' // 网页标题
@ -68,7 +69,9 @@ module.exports = {
filename: '[path].gz[query]', // 压缩后的文件名 filename: '[path].gz[query]', // 压缩后的文件名
algorithm: 'gzip', // 使用gzip压缩 algorithm: 'gzip', // 使用gzip压缩
minRatio: 0.8 // 压缩率小于1才会压缩 minRatio: 0.8 // 压缩率小于1才会压缩
}) }),
// analayzer
new BundleAnalyzerPlugin()
], ],
}, },
chainWebpack(config) { chainWebpack(config) {